Our artifact comprises of two distinct parts: a unified gem5 / DRAMSim2 model (for performance evaluation), and a Rosette model (for security verification). The unified gem5/DRAMSim2 model is able to evaluate the performance of DAGguise and FS-BTA against an insecure baseline. We use gem5’s OoO core to perform baseline measurements, profile candidate rDAGs, and report final performance numbers. We also include the sample victim programs (DocDist and DNA) as described in the paper, in addition to an rDAG generation tool, and plotting scripts for Figures 7 and 9. The Rosette model symbolically executes the DAGguise system and verifies the Security Property with K-Induction as described in Section 5 of the paper.
